WebBorn in Germany, artist Thea Flanagan studied at the University of Maine, Keane College and Pennsylvania State University after receiving a BS in Art Education from Mansfield University. She taught junior and senior high art in Pennsylvania and Maine prior to turning her attention to fine art in 1986. With a fondness for texture, Thea began as ...
